Tyriq Withers (born 15 July 1998) is an American actor best known for his roles as Tim in Hulu series Tell Me Lies and Connor Tibbs in Paramount+ series The Game.
Withers was born in Jacksonville, Florida to a white mother and black father. He has an older brother named Kionte who died in 2021 after a car accident.[1] Withers attended Florida State University where he was part of the 2017 Florida State Seminoles football team and played as a wide receiver.[2] He graduated with degrees in Business and Marketing in 2022.[3]
Wither's first major role came in 2022 when he played one of the leading roles opposite George Wallace in "Rich Wigga, Poor Wigga", an episode of the anthology series Atlanta.[4]
Withers also landed recurring roles in both The Game as Connor Tibbs and as Tim in Tell Me Lies.[5]
In July 2024, it was announced that Tyriq Withers had been cast in a yet untitled I Know What You Did Last Summer reboot alongside Camila Mendes and Madelyn Cline set to be released in July 2025.[6]
